That's just the thing, there doesn't seem to be any written guidelines for this discount from Disney. The Jewelry store on Main Street DOES give a discount since I bought a watch there and got the 20% off. But there is no where to go to look up what the restrictions might be.
For example, I got 20% off a bottle of water at Epcot at a merchandise stand. The CM told me that the discount is available at a merchandise stand that happens to sell water but not at a snack stand. I tried to buy a bottle of water with the discount at a merchandise stand in Animal Kingdom and I was told there that no food items qualify. They couldn't explain why I got the 20% off in Epcot the day before. :confused3
